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
992 85 5298394 198960 70231115294
386103527 89883079
386103527 89883079
1715133386 2188783 89423 74
All about undefined
Interested in learning more?
386103527 89883079
1715133386 2188783 89423 74
See more
02 455
29885 28647331747 27 209
See more
4866630682 545 3412400412
9326 7499 515177 453671876
See more